A comparison of three restorative techniques for endodontically treated anterior teeth.

J L Brandal, J I Nicholls, G W Harrington.   

Abstract

An in vitro study of 45 teeth compared the failure loads of endodontically treated teeth restored with pin and amalgams, Para-Post dowel and composite, and glass ionomer/amalgam alloy coronal-radicular buildups. The following conclusions were made. The Para-Post and composite buildups exhibited the highest mean failure load, 35.3 kg. The mean failure load for pin and amalgam buildups was 27.9 kg. Glass ionomer/amalgam alloy coronal-radicular buildups exhibited the lowest mean failure load, 14.1 kg. Restoration of endodontically treated anterior teeth with glass ionomer/amalgam alloy coronal-radicular buildups is contraindicated.
